Aurora Sheboygan Pricing: General Anesthesia for First Half Hour Costs $1,680
Aurora Medical Center Sheboygan County, located at 3400 Union Ave in Sheboygan, WI, offers a range of medical services, including general anesthesia for surgical procedures. The cost for the first half-hour of general anesthesia at this facility is $1,680. This fee covers the administration of anesthesia by a qualified anesthesiologist or nurse anesthetist, ensuring that patients remain unconscious and pain-free during the initial phase of their surgical procedure. The pricing reflects the expertise, equipment, and medications required to safely manage anesthesia.
What is general anesthesia? – General anesthesia is a medically induced state of unconsciousness used during surgeries to ensure patients do not feel pain and remain unaware of the procedure.
Why is general anesthesia necessary? – It is necessary for procedures that would otherwise be too painful or complex to perform while a patient is awake, ensuring both patient comfort and surgical precision.
How is the cost of general anesthesia determined? – The cost is determined by factors such as the duration of the procedure, the complexity of the anesthesia required, and the expertise of the medical professionals involved.
Is the $1,680 fee for general anesthesia a standard rate? – This fee is specific to Aurora Medical Center Sheboygan County and covers the first half-hour of anesthesia; additional time may incur further charges.
What does the fee for general anesthesia include? – The fee includes the anesthetic drugs, monitoring equipment, and the services of the anesthesia team for the first half-hour of the procedure.
Can insurance cover the cost of general anesthesia? – Many insurance plans cover anesthesia costs, but coverage can vary; patients should check with their provider for specific details.
What happens if the anesthesia lasts longer than half an hour? – Additional charges may apply if the anesthesia is required for longer than the initial half-hour; these costs should be discussed with the healthcare provider beforehand.
Are there any risks associated with general anesthesia? – While generally safe, general anesthesia carries some risks, including allergic reactions and complications; these are minimized by thorough pre-operative assessments and monitoring.
